For what its worth, an 06 facelift with 54k on it which was also black with the same options plus satnav/bluetooth and BMW Approved Used check + warranty etc. recently sold for 10k. So I'd say there's about a 300-500 premium for being from BMW+Nav over a normal dealer, then a £500 or so premium for a dealer over private.

Incase you were wondering why your getting little/no interest, I don't want to poo-poo your thread or anything just giving you my perspective as someone looking to buy a Z4 in the next 3 months.
